1. 什么是区块链钱包?
区块链钱包是用户存储和管理其加密货币资产的工具。不同于传统银行账户,区块链钱包的运行不依赖中央机构,而是依靠区块链网络中的去中心化机制。以太坊(Ethereum)是一个重要的平台,用户可以在其上创建和管理以太币(ETH)及相关代币。区块链钱包可以分为热钱包和冷钱包两种,热钱包通常连接到互联网,方便进行交易;而冷钱包则是离线储存,安全性更高。
2. ETH钱包的基础结构
ETH钱包的核心是私钥和公钥。用户通过私钥控制其钱包中的资产,而公钥则可以公开与他人进行交易。钱包的生成过程实际上是基于一对密钥的生成,这个过程涉及一些密码学技术,例如椭圆曲线加密(ECC)。为了确保安全性,私钥应该被妥善保管,而公钥则可以自由共享。生成钱包的过程中,除了私钥和公钥,通常还会生成一个钱包地址,这是用于接收资产的标识。
3. ETH钱包生成的技术原理
ETH钱包生成的过程包括几个主要步骤:首先,通过密码学算法生成随机数;然后,使用该随机数生成私钥;接下来,利用私钥生成公钥;最后,公钥经过哈希函数处理生成钱包地址。整个过程强调随机性和安全性。此外,许多钱包在生成时还会加入助记词,帮助用户更容易地备份和恢复钱包。助记词通常是由12-24个单词组成的,可以用于生成相同的私钥和地址。
4. ETH钱包的种类
ETH钱包主要有以下几种类型:软钱包(软件钱包)、硬钱包(硬件钱包)、纸钱包等。软钱包可以运行在电脑或手机上,方便快捷但存在一定安全风险;硬钱包是一种专用设备,存储在离线状态,安全性强但使用不如软钱包便利;纸钱包则是将私钥和公钥打印在纸上,完全离线存储,防止网络攻击,但易受物理损坏。
5. 与ETH钱包相关的问题
如何安全地存储和管理ETH钱包的私钥?
私钥是控制区块链钱包的关键,保护私钥的安全是至关重要的。一方面,用户可以选择硬件钱包来安全地存储私钥,因为它们不连接到互联网,不容易受到黑客攻击。另一方面,用户可以将私钥加密存储,并在网络未连接时进行离线备份。此外,用户还可以利用助记词进行备份,确保在丢失设备的情况下能够还是找回钱包。建议用户避免将私钥存储在云存储中,避免遭到网络攻击。
如何从助记词恢复ETH钱包?
助记词是一组随机生成的词,它可以用来恢复ETH钱包。用户可以在创建钱包时生成助记词,确保将其妥善保存。一旦需要恢复钱包,用户可以在支持助记词恢复功能的钱包软件中输入这些单词,按顺序输入并确认。软件将会通过助记词重新生成私钥和公钥,从而恢复钱包内的资产。因此,用户必须始终保护好助记词,因为任何掌握了助记词的人都能够访问到你的资产。
热钱包和冷钱包各自的优缺点是什么?
热钱包通常是指在线钱包(例如手机钱包、网页钱包),方便用户随时随地进行交易。它的优点是容易访问,适合频繁交易的用户。然而,热钱包由于连接互联网,面临着黑客攻击及其他安全风险。冷钱包则是指离线存储的钱包,例如硬件钱包和纸钱包。冷钱包的安全性较高,能有效保护用户资产,但使用时相对不便,对于频繁交易的用户可能不够实用。因此,用户应根据自己的需求选择合适的存储方式,或结合使用热钱包和冷钱包。
ETH钱包生成的随机数如何保证安全性?
生成 ETH 钱包的随机数是关键步骤,随机数的安全性直接关系到私钥的安全。一般来说,这些随机数通过高品质的随机数生成器(如基于操作系统的熵源、硬件随机数生成器等)产生。安全的随机数生成器能够确保每次生成的随机数都是唯一且不可预测的,从而防止暴力破解等攻击。同时,建议用户在生成钱包之前关闭其他程序,确保没有潜在的安全隐患,保持计算机环境的安全。
总结来看,ETH钱包生成原理是一系列复杂而又精密的过程,涉及到密码学、随机数生成等诸多领域。对于每个用户来说,理解钱包的工作原理和安全基础知识是保护自己资产的第一步。